A Town Hall Meeting Held

After protests and several arrests, a town hall meeting has been planned for Monday in response to the acquittal of a former Houston police officer accused in the beating of a teen burglary suspect.

 
The not guilty verdict in the Andrew Blomberg beating trial set off a series of protests and some activists even met with Harris County District Attorney Pat Lykos, demanding to know why the Blomberg jury was all white.


Some of those questions were expected to be answered at the town hall meeting last night. Three more former HPD officers on the tape are still awaiting trial.
 

Drew Ryser, Philip Bryan and Raad Hassan are all charged with official oppression.
Chad Holley has also filed a federal civil rights suit against all four of the former officers charged in the case.
